What: Mississippi Humanities Council Community Read: a free four-week literary discussion series exploring the themes, questions, and challenges of celebrating Blues music in Mississippi through the lens of B. Brian Foster's I Don’t Like the Blues: Race, Place and the Backbeat of Black Life.
When: September 2, 9, 16, and 23 (all Wednesdays), followed by a visit to Blue Monday, presented by the Central Mississippi Blues Society, on October 5. Foster himself will join the discussion on Sept 2.
Where: All four September meetings will take place in the Christian Center. Rides will be available to Hal & Mal's for Blue Monday.
Additional Details: Refreshments provided! All participants will receive a free copy of I Don't Like the Blues, courtesy of the Mississippi Humanities Council, as well as free admission to Blue Monday.
